Environmental Project Manager Jobs in New Jersey

An Environmental Project Manager in the environmental industry is responsible for planning, coordinating, and overseeing projects related to environmental conservation and sustainability. Their duties may include conducting environmental assessments, planning and implementing conservation projects, and ensuring compliance with environmental regulations. They liaise with clients, stakeholders, and team members to ensure projects are completed on time and within budget. They are also responsible for risk management and quality assurance in their projects.

To be successful in this role, an Environmental Project Manager must have strong leadership, communication, and project management skills. They should also have a deep understanding of environmental regulations and sustainability issues. A bachelor's degree in Environmental Science, Environmental Engineering, or a related field is typically required. Certifications such as the Certified Environmental Professional (CEP) or the Project Management Professional (PMP) can also be beneficial. Prior to becoming an Environmental Project Manager, a person may have roles such as an Environmental Consultant, Environmental Engineer, or Environmental Analyst.

Highest Education Level

Environmental Project Managers in New Jersey off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
52.8%
Master's Degree
33.0%
Doctorate Degree
6.3%
High School or GED
2.7%
Associate's Degree
2.7%
Vocational Degree or Certification
2.1%
Some College
0.4%
Some High School
0.1%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Environmental Project Managers in New Jersey
2-4 years
25.7%
4-6 years
19.3%
1-2 years
15.9%
10+ years
14.8%
8-10 years
13.7%
6-8 years
7.3%
None
3.3%
